Ed Orgeron and the LSU coaching staff landed a bigtime commitment from four-star offensive tackle Emery Jones on Friday night.

Jones, a 6-4, 340-pound prospect from Catholic HS in Baton Rouge is rated the No. 9 offensive tackle in the country for the class of 2022, according to 247Sports.

He committed to the Tigers over offers from Alabama, Auburn, Arkansas, Florida State, Tennessee, and many others.
